powerpc/eeh: Reduce to one the number of places where edev is allocated



arch/powerpc/kernel/eeh_dev.c:57 is the only legit place where edev
is allocated; other 2 places allocate it on stack and in the heap for
a very short period of time to use eeh_pe_get() as takes edev.

This changes eeh_pe_get() to receive required parameters explicitly.

This removes unnecessary temporary allocation of edev.

This uses the "pe_no" name instead of the "pe_config_addr" name as
it actually is a PE number and not a config space address as it seemed.
